The process of manufacturing conveyor belts involves several stages, starting from the selection of materials to the final assembly of the belt. The materials used in the production of conveyor belts can vary depending on the intended application and environment. Common materials used in conveyor belt manufacturing include rubber, PVC, nylon, and polyester, which are chosen for their durability, flexibility, and resistance to abrasion.

The design of a conveyor belt is also an important aspect of the manufacturing process. Conveyor belt manufacturers use advanced CAD software to create detailed blueprints of the belt, taking into account factors such as the length, width, and thickness of the belt, as well as the type of material being transported. The design phase is crucial in ensuring that the conveyor belt meets the specific requirements of the customer and complies with industry standards.

Once the design phase is complete, the manufacturing process can begin. Conveyor belt manufacturers use a combination of automated machinery and skilled labor to produce high-quality conveyor belts efficiently. The materials are cut to size, coated with adhesives, and assembled in layers to create a strong and durable belt. Quality control measures are implemented throughout the manufacturing process to ensure that the conveyor belt meets strict standards for safety and performance.

In addition to the production of standard conveyor belts, manufacturers also offer custom conveyor belt solutions for specialized applications. Custom conveyor belts may feature unique materials, coatings, or designs tailored to specific industries or environments. For example, conveyor belts used in food processing facilities may have antimicrobial coatings to prevent the growth of bacteria, while belts used in the mining industry may be reinforced with steel cords for added strength.
